It is hard to believe it was more than two years ago that Christchurch New Zealand experienced a devastating earthquake.
February 22, 2011 will be remembered by the world, especially by those who experienced the event.
The Down Under Club of Winnipeg pulled together a benefit event on April 7th, 2011, headed up by Lynley Davidson.
The web site was created and will live on at http://handsup4nz.wordpress.com after the expiry of the dedicated original web address.

Kiwi made new boss of Commonwealth Foundation
The Rt Hon Sir Anand Satyanand of New Zealand is the new chairman of the Commonwealth Foundation in Marlborough House, London. Appointed by heads of government, he will serve an initial term of up to two years. Continue reading
